- Domestic Smartphone users has increased from 470,000 on November, 2009 to 1 million on March, 2011, and over 20 million in 28th of October, 2011. With this rapid growth, it is expected that the number of Smartphone users will reach over 30 million.
- 4 out of 10 Koreans are using Smart phones, and the majority of 25 million economic populations are using Smartphones.
